Fix issue with needToken patch to Api.upload
authorMark Holmquist <mtraceur@member.fsf.org>
Thu, 16 Jul 2015 14:15:52 +0000 (09:15 -0500)
committerMark Holmquist <mtraceur@member.fsf.org>
Thu, 16 Jul 2015 14:15:52 +0000 (09:15 -0500)
Fails currently for formData-enabled browsers where a token is not needed.

Change-Id: If5f1e9257fae770ea63a50ba8454e6617c77a455

resources/src/mediawiki.api/mediawiki.api.upload.js

index 6347828..b398f98 100644 (file)
                                        // Mark the edit token as bad, it's been used.
                                        api.badToken( 'edit' );
                                } );
+                       } else {
+                               xhr.send( formData );
                        }
 
                        return deferred.promise();